The company Northwest River Supplies, or NRS for short, provides supplies for people who like to go on the river. Vacationing with NRS rafting supplies is a great way to enjoy the river. States such as Oregon, Colorado, and Tennessee all have NRS rafting supplies and products for people who love to raft on the river. The company was started in 1972 by Bill Parks. With a simple $2000 investment, NRS has grown to become one of the United States top companies for rafting supplies. Regardless of where a person lives, he or she is sure to find NRS rafting supplies at a local river store.

Northwest River Supplies started as a humble dream by Bill Parks. He had a $2000 investment and a garage to work with. From there, the company has grown to become one of the United States top rafting suppliers. If you go rafting, be sure to bring some NRS products with you, as they are cheap and high quality. Mr. Parks has always been a budget boater, and the NRS company has not lost that plan.
